Biography

Samir Salem Al-Bawri (Member, IEEE) received the Master of Science degree in wireless communication engineering from Yarmouk University, Jordan, in 2009, and the Doctor of Philosophy degree in communication engineering from Universiti Malaysia Perlis (UniMAP), Malaysia, in 2018. He has worked as a Lecturer with the Faculty of Engineering and Petroleum, Hadhramout University (HU), Yemen, from December 2009 to August 2014. He worked as a Graduate Research Assistance with UniMAP, from 2015 to 2018. He has worked as a Postdoctoral Researcher Fellow with Multimedia University (MMU), Cyberjaya, Malaysia, for one year. He is currently affiliated as a Senior Lecturer/a Research Fellow with the Center for Space Science, Institute of Climate Change, Universiti Kebangsaan Malaysia (UKM). He has authored or coauthored over (25) ISI and SCOPUS published journal; (22) conference proceeding on various topics related to antennas, microwaves, and electromagnetic radiation analysis with one inventory patent. His research interests include design and evaluation of multi-element antennas, metamaterials, electromagnetic radiation analysis, localization estimation techniques, and wireless propagation.
